Latest Patents
One of her latest patents is for "Reduced side-effect hemoglobin compositions." This invention relates to novel hemoglobin compositions, specifically recombinant mutant hemoglobin compositions. These compositions aim to eliminate or substantially reduce the creation of heart lesions, gastrointestinal discomfort, pressor effects, and endotoxin hypersensitivity associated with the administration of extracellular hemoglobin compositions. The applications described include treatments for anemia, head injury, hemorrhage or hypovolemia, ischemia, cachexia, sickle cell crisis, and stroke. Additionally, her work enhances cancer treatments, stimulates hematopoiesis, improves the repair of physically damaged tissues, alleviates cardiogenic shock, and aids in shock resuscitation.
Another significant patent is for a "Fibrin/fibrinogen-binding conjugate." This invention involves a conjugate for forming a depot for the sustained release of a pharmaceutically active substance from a fibrin clot. The conjugate comprises a fibrin/fibrinogen binding moiety bound to a pharmaceutically active substance, either directly or via an intervening substance capturing moiety such as an antibody. It can also be a recombinant fusion protein that includes a fibrin/fibrinogen binding moiety, such as the VEGFC-terminal domain, fused to a wound-healing substance like leptin.
